Home
last modified time | relevance | path

Searched refs:EvqVaryingOut (Results 1 – 25 of 36) sorted by relevance

12

/external/swiftshader/src/OpenGL/compiler/
DBaseTypes.h356 EvqVaryingOut, // vertex shaders only read/write enumerator
442 case EvqVaryingOut: return "varying"; break; in getQualifierString()
DParseHelper.cpp37 case EvqVaryingOut: in IsVaryingOut()
664 case EvqVaryingOut: in structQualifierErrorCheck()
707 case EvqVaryingOut: in singleDeclarationErrorCheck()
1107 case EvqVaryingOut: in es3InvariantErrorCheck()
1348 if((qualifier == EvqVaryingIn || qualifier == EvqVaryingOut) && in addFullySpecifiedType()
DOutputASM.cpp668 case EvqVaryingOut: in visitSymbol()
2870 case EvqVaryingOut: return sw::Shader::PARAMETER_OUTPUT; in registerType()
2942 case EvqVaryingOut: return varyingRegister(operand); in registerIndex()
Dglslang.y907 $$.setBasic(EbtVoid, EvqVaryingOut, @1);
/external/deqp-deps/glslang/glslang/Include/
DBaseTypes.h90EvqVaryingOut, // pipeline output, read/write, also supercategory for all built-ins not include… enumerator
325 case EvqVaryingOut: return "out"; break; in GetStorageQualifierString()
DTypes.h677 case EvqVaryingOut: in isPipeOutput()
734 case EvqVaryingOut: in isIo()
749 case EvqVaryingOut: in isLinkable()
1662 case EvqVaryingOut: in getShaderInterface()
/external/angle/third_party/vulkan-deps/glslang/src/glslang/Include/
DBaseTypes.h94EvqVaryingOut, // pipeline output, read/write, also supercategory for all built-ins not include… enumerator
335 case EvqVaryingOut: return "out"; break; in GetStorageQualifierString()
DTypes.h701 case EvqVaryingOut: in isPipeOutput()
758 case EvqVaryingOut: in isIo()
773 case EvqVaryingOut: in isLinkable()
1776 case EvqVaryingOut: in getShaderInterface()
/external/angle/third_party/vulkan-deps/glslang/src/glslang/MachineIndependent/
DlinkValidate.cpp129 …[](TIntermNode* node) {return node->getAsSymbolNode()->getQualifier().storage != EvqVaryingOut; }); in checkStageIO()
519 …(stage < unitStage && symbol->getQualifier().storage == EvqVaryingOut && unitSymbol->getQualifier… in isSameInterface()
520 …ol->getQualifier().storage == EvqVaryingIn && unitSymbol->getQualifier().storage == EvqVaryingOut); in isSameInterface()
875 …ol.getQualifier().storage == EvqVaryingIn && unitSymbol.getQualifier().storage == EvqVaryingOut) || in mergeErrorCheck()
876 …(symbol.getQualifier().storage == EvqVaryingOut && unitSymbol.getQualifier().storage == EvqVarying… in mergeErrorCheck()
1364 if (qualifier.storage == EvqVaryingOut && qualifier.builtIn == EbvNone) { in inOutLocationCheck()
1399 if (symbolNode.getQualifier().storage == EvqVaryingOut && in userOutputUsed()
2161 (language == EShLangTessControl &&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
2165 (language == EShLangMeshNV &&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
DParseHelper.cpp681 (language == EShLangTessControl &&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
685 (language == EShLangMeshNV &&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
2862 …if (leftType.getQualifier().storage == EvqVaryingOut && ! leftType.getQualifier().patch && binaryN… in lValueErrorCheck()
3653 qualifier.storage = EvqVaryingOut; in globalQualifierFixCheck()
3719 if (qualifier.storage != EvqVaryingIn && qualifier.storage != EvqVaryingOut) in globalQualifierTypeCheck()
3746 … else if (qualifier.storage == EvqVaryingOut && language == EShLangVertex && version == 300) in globalQualifierTypeCheck()
4172 if (type.getQualifier().storage == EvqVaryingOut && language == EShLangVertex) { in arrayError()
4184 if (type.getQualifier().storage == EvqVaryingOut && language == EShLangFragment) { in arrayError()
4257 (qualifier.storage == EvqVaryingOut && ! qualifier.isPatch())) in arraySizesCheck()
4264 qualifier.storage == EvqVaryingOut) in arraySizesCheck()
[all …]
Diomapper.cpp80 else if (base->getQualifier().storage == EvqVaryingOut) in visitSymbol()
122 else if (base->getQualifier().storage == EvqVaryingOut) in visitSymbol()
533 } else if (base->getQualifier().storage == EvqVaryingOut) { in operator ()()
1192 case EvqVaryingOut: in reserverStorageSlot()
1197 stage = storage == EvqVaryingOut ? currentStage : stage; in reserverStorageSlot()
/external/angle/src/compiler/translator/
DBaseTypes.h995 EvqVaryingOut, // vertex shaders only read/write enumerator
1170 case EvqVaryingOut: in IsShaderOut()
1459 case EvqVaryingOut: return "varying"; in getQualifierString()
Dutil.cpp464 case EvqVaryingOut: in IsVaryingOut()
577 case EvqVaryingOut: in GetInterpolationType()
DUtilsHLSL.cpp1056 case EvqVaryingOut: in InterpolationString()
DOutputGLSLBase.cpp361 case EvqVaryingOut: in mapQualifierToString()
DTranslatorVulkan.cpp305 TVariable *anglePosition = AddANGLEPositionVaryingDeclaration(root, symbolTable, EvqVaryingOut); in AddBresenhamEmulationVS()
DCollectVariables.cpp928 case EvqVaryingOut: in recordVarying()
DParseContext.cpp1619 case EvqVaryingOut: in nonEmptyDeclarationErrorCheck()
2539 if ((returnType.qualifier == EvqVaryingIn || returnType.qualifier == EvqVaryingOut) && in addFullySpecifiedType()
2871 if (qualifier == EvqVaryingOut || qualifier == EvqVertexOut) in parseSingleDeclaration()
5440 return parseGlobalStorageQualifier(EvqVaryingOut, loc); in parseVaryingQualifier()
/external/deqp-deps/glslang/glslang/MachineIndependent/
DParseHelper.cpp579 (language == EShLangTessControl &&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
583 (language == EShLangMeshNV && type.getQualifier().storage == EvqVaryingOut && in isIoResizeArray()
2655 …if (leftType.getQualifier().storage == EvqVaryingOut && ! leftType.getQualifier().patch && binaryN… in lValueErrorCheck()
3425 qualifier.storage = EvqVaryingOut; in globalQualifierFixCheck()
3483 if (qualifier.storage != EvqVaryingIn && qualifier.storage != EvqVaryingOut) in globalQualifierTypeCheck()
3510 … else if (qualifier.storage == EvqVaryingOut && language == EShLangVertex && version == 300) in globalQualifierTypeCheck()
3901 if (type.getQualifier().storage == EvqVaryingOut && language == EShLangVertex) { in arrayError()
3913 if (type.getQualifier().storage == EvqVaryingOut && language == EShLangFragment) { in arrayError()
3986 (qualifier.storage == EvqVaryingOut && ! qualifier.isPatch())) in arraySizesCheck()
3993 qualifier.storage == EvqVaryingOut) in arraySizesCheck()
[all …]
Diomapper.cpp80 else if (base->getQualifier().storage == EvqVaryingOut) in visitSymbol()
122 else if (base->getQualifier().storage == EvqVaryingOut) in visitSymbol()
527 } else if (base->getQualifier().storage == EvqVaryingOut) { in operator ()()
1181 case EvqVaryingOut: in reserverStorageSlot()
1186 stage = storage == EvqVaryingOut ? currentStage : stage; in reserverStorageSlot()
DlinkValidate.cpp1035 if (qualifier.storage == EvqVaryingOut && qualifier.builtIn == EbvNone) { in inOutLocationCheck()
1070 if (symbolNode.getQualifier().storage == EvqVaryingOut && in userOutputUsed()
/external/angle/src/tests/compiler_tests/
DInitOutputVariables_test.cpp324 CreateLValueNode(ImmutableString("out1"), TType(EbtFloat, EbpMedium, EvqVaryingOut, 4)); in TEST_F()
/external/angle/src/compiler/translator/TranslatorMetalDirect/
DPipeline.cpp53 case TQualifier::EvqVaryingOut: in uses()
/external/deqp-deps/glslang/glslang/HLSL/
DhlslParseHelper.cpp1161 case EvqVaryingOut: in shouldFlatten()
1550 if (qualifier.storage == EvqVaryingIn || qualifier.storage == EvqVaryingOut) { in assignToInterface()
2346 else if (storage == EvqVaryingOut && newLists->second.output) in remapEntryPointIO()
2373 … returnValue = makeIoVariable("@entryPointOutput", function.getWritableType(), EvqVaryingOut); in remapEntryPointIO()
2384 returnValue = makeIoVariable("@entryPointOutput", outputType, EvqVaryingOut); in remapEntryPointIO()
2386 … returnValue = makeIoVariable("@entryPointOutput", function.getWritableType(), EvqVaryingOut); in remapEntryPointIO()
2399 … TVariable* argAsGlobal = makeIoVariable(function[i].name->c_str(), paramType, EvqVaryingOut); in remapEntryPointIO()
6679 qualifier.storage = EvqVaryingOut; in globalQualifierFix()
7968 if (dst.storage == EvqVaryingOut) { in inheritGlobalDefaults()
8682 case EvqVaryingOut: in declareBlock()
[all …]
/external/angle/third_party/vulkan-deps/glslang/src/glslang/HLSL/
DhlslParseHelper.cpp1161 case EvqVaryingOut: in shouldFlatten()
1550 if (qualifier.storage == EvqVaryingIn || qualifier.storage == EvqVaryingOut) { in assignToInterface()
2346 else if (storage == EvqVaryingOut && newLists->second.output) in remapEntryPointIO()
2373 … returnValue = makeIoVariable("@entryPointOutput", function.getWritableType(), EvqVaryingOut); in remapEntryPointIO()
2384 returnValue = makeIoVariable("@entryPointOutput", outputType, EvqVaryingOut); in remapEntryPointIO()
2386 … returnValue = makeIoVariable("@entryPointOutput", function.getWritableType(), EvqVaryingOut); in remapEntryPointIO()
2399 … TVariable* argAsGlobal = makeIoVariable(function[i].name->c_str(), paramType, EvqVaryingOut); in remapEntryPointIO()
6683 qualifier.storage = EvqVaryingOut; in globalQualifierFix()
7972 if (dst.storage == EvqVaryingOut) { in inheritGlobalDefaults()
8686 case EvqVaryingOut: in declareBlock()
[all …]

12